Output 76023e315fbf0eabbc211bd06a37fa0482cc31c09f2b7aed23c8cdbe44657aba:86

value
94151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a89893a12f2712cd3f7cdfc2c04aa42a7e3e808 OP_EQUAL
address
3EKXwBs3kvE2sUMEqytn365kXBGWW1Go4S
transaction
76023e315fbf0eabbc211bd06a37fa0482cc31c09f2b7aed23c8cdbe44657aba
spent
true